USMNT vs Guatemala National Football Team Lineups at a Glance
Let’s start by looking at the two starting lineups. Both teams used similar setups, but with different types of players.
USMNT Starting XI (4-2-3-1):
-
Goalkeeper: Matt Freese
-
Defenders: Alex Freeman, Chris Richards, Tim Ream (C), Max Arfsten
-
Midfielders: Tyler Adams, Luca de la Torre, Sebastian Berhalter, Malik Tillman, Diego Luna
-
Forward: Patrick Agyemang
Guatemala Starting XI (4-3-3):
-
Goalkeeper: Kenderson Navarro
-
Defenders: Aaron Herrera, José Pinto (C), Nicolás Samayoa, José Morales
-
Midfielders: Stheven Robles, José Rosales, Rudy Muñoz
-
Forwards: Rubio Rubín, Óscar Santis, Carlos Mejía (later subbed by Escobar)

Big Moments That Changed the Game
This match had a few big moments that changed everything. And most of them came early.
In just the 4th minute, Diego Luna scored the first goal for the US. The ball bounced off a blocked shot, and Luna was ready. He kicked it in from close range and gave the USMNT the perfect start.
Only 11 minutes later, Luna did it again! He hit a powerful shot from outside the box and made it 2-0. It was a great strike, and the crowd in St. Louis went wild.
In the 80th minute, Olger Escobar gave Guatemala some hope. He scored from inside the box to make it 2-1. But even with that goal, the US defense stayed strong and held on to the win.
